  • About Dr Louise Bowles

    GMC number: 4212889

    Year qualified: 1995

    Place of primary qualification: University of London

    Dr Bowles is a highly respected hematologist specialising in thrombosis and hemostasis. She completed her medical degree at the University of London and undertook specialty training in hematology at the University College Hospital, The Royal Free Hospital, and Great Ormond Street Hospital. Following her medical rotations, Dr Bowles has been serving as a consultant in thrombosis and hemostasis since 2008.

    Dr Bowles is currently affiliated with a leading hospital where she runs dedicated bleeding and thrombosis clinics. She also collaborates with colleagues in women's health to offer combined clinics, providing comprehensive care for patients with complex needs. Her areas of expertise include the diagnosis and treatment of blood clotting disorders, such as pulmonary embolus and deep vein thrombosis. She is proficient in offering advice and treatment options for anticoagulation.

    One of Dr Bowles' particular interests lies in the impact of blood clotting disorders on women's health, including conditions that lead to heavy menstrual bleeding. Her extensive knowledge in this area allows her to provide specialised care and treatment plans tailored to the unique needs of her patients.

    In addition to her clinical work, Dr Bowles has made significant contributions to the field through her authorship of numerous local and national guidelines on thrombosis and hemostasis. She is also an esteemed teacher and examiner for The Royal College of Pathologists, where she plays a crucial role in educating the next generation of medical professionals.
